Understanding the Significance of Performance Metrics in Live Casino Operations

Live casino gaming embodies a blend of real-time interaction, high-definition streaming, and complex software integration. Ensuring a seamless experience requires continuous monitoring of numerous parameters:

  • Game fairness: Guaranteeing that outcomes are not rigged or biased.
  • Technical stability: Minimising latency, preventing disconnections, and reducing technical errors.
  • User engagement: Analyzing player interaction patterns and retention rates.
  • Operational efficiency: Streamlining server loads, data handling, and customer support responsiveness.

Quantitative tools that synthesize these variables into a single, actionable score facilitate informed decision-making, competitive benchmarking, and regulatory compliance.

The SuperBet Performance Score: A Quantitative Benchmark for Live Casino Excellence

Within this landscape, the SuperBet performance score emerges as a credible indicator of operational health and game integrity. This metric aggregates data on streaming quality, bet processing efficiency, game fairness, and user experience into a consolidated score, allowing operators and regulators to benchmark performance effectively.

Its methodology incorporates several vital parameters, such as:

  1. Latency Metrics: How swiftly do bets register, and how immediate is the game response?
  2. Error Rates: Frequency of glitches, disconnections, or misreported outcomes.
  3. Fairness Indicators: Compliance with RNG audits and random outcome validation.
  4. User Feedback: Direct input from players regarding interface usability and streaming clarity.

Data-Driven Insights from the SuperBet Scoring System

Parameter Benchmark Range Industry Standard Implication
Latency (ms) 200–400 Below 300 ms Supports smooth betting experience; delays above 400 ms detract from user satisfaction.
Error Rate (%) Below 1% 0.1–0.5% Low error rates indicate robust systems and minimal customer complaints.
Fairness Compliance 100% audited Certifications from recognised RNG auditors Ensures game integrity and builds trust with players.
User Satisfaction (out of 10) 7–10 Average above 8 Higher scores correlate with sustained engagement and retention.
